data-e-type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Thermal cameras convert the infrared radiation emitted by bodies or objects\u2014invisible<br \/>to the human eye\u2014into visible images in real time. In other words, they measure the<br \/>temperature of an object without physical contact. Unlike pyrometers, thermal<\/p><p>imaging cameras generate a complete image of the heat distribution, facilitating vision<br \/>in total darkness and the identification of hot or cold spots.<\/p><p>They typically use a sensor called a microbolometer, whose electrical resistance<br \/>changes when heated by the received radiation. Their maximum sensitivity is in the<br \/>long-wave infrared (LWIR) range, although there are also cameras in the medium-wave<br \/>infrared (MWIR) range. Unlike catalytic or metal-oxide gas sensors,<br \/>they are highly accurate, stable, and used for continuous monitoring in safety and air<br \/>quality applications.<\/p><p>NDIR sensors are commonly used to prevent accidents in industry, as well as to<br \/>monitor proper production by quantifying gases in the environment. They are also<br \/>frequently used in domestic applications to detect hazardous gases, such as carbon monoxide, or other gases of interest, such as carbon dioxide. Finally, they can be used in environmental monitoring for the detection and quantification of hazardous particles (VOCs, volatile organic compounds) and refrigerant non-destructively, making them essential in quality control, pharmaceutical research, and chemical analysis.<\/p><p>They work by emitting infrared light, which strikes the sample, causing vibrations in<br \/>the molecular bonds of the material being detected.
